Dr. Lev-Weissberg was born in former Soviet Union and came to US at a young age with his family. He excelled in school and completed his undergraduate studies in three years at University of Illinois, graduating with highest distinction in Biological Sciences, minor in history and chemistry. After entering medical school at University of Illinois Chicago Campus, Dr. Lev-Weissberg took interest in primary care. In medical school, he excelled academically and earned recognition by being selected to receive a prestigious General Assembly Scholarship for total tuition in his final year of medical school. He graduated in the top 25% of medical students at UIC-COM. Dr. Lev-Weissberg, completed his residency in internal medicine at Lutheran General hospital, earning numerous awards . Dr. Lev-Weissberg presented multiple times at the regional and national level. Dr. Lev-Weissberg has numerous clinical interests including sleep disorders, metabolism and diabetes, rheumatologic diseases, psychosomatic disorders. He is actively studying the role of glucagon-related-peptide in the pathogenesis of metabolic syndrome and sleep apnea. True to his interest in medical education, Dr. Lev-Weissberg teaches UIC students and Lutheran General Hospital Residents, as well as nurse practitioner students from across the country. He has a rank of Clinical Assistant Professor of Medicine at University of Illinois. Dr. Lev-Weissberg was appointed a chairman of medication safety committee and actively serves on Pharmacy and Therapeutics Committee. He is active in resident recruitment and selection process at Lutheran General Hospital.
